Output ea23bf7e29901a1d6e05bfffdc81230e9251a3ca7d24d34b9e1a199acbb1f70f:2

value
1733061
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e424ad4f3dc95c98a8345a139022801b798d97e475be574aee0cf868ca6b5772
address
tb1pusj26neae9wf32p5tgfeqg5qrducm9lywkl9wjhwpnux3jnt2aeqcp7naa
transaction
ea23bf7e29901a1d6e05bfffdc81230e9251a3ca7d24d34b9e1a199acbb1f70f
confirmations
20853
spent
true